8 Rules of Dog Show Etiquette

It’s OK to pet every dog you see at a dog show, right? If you thought that, you may find yourself in trouble with long-time participants on the dog show circuit.

For first time dog show attendees, the myriad of activities going on may be a cause of confusion, and without an official list of do’s and don’ts for dog shows it’s easy to act out in ways you may not know were improper. To help clear the air, Petside’s pet expert Charlotte Reed shares 8 rules for proper dog show etiquette from the dog show world’s biggest stage: the Westminster Kennel Club show!
